Comprehending Interstitial Lung Disease

Interstitial lung disease is a group of lung disorders that affect the interstitium, the tissue and space around the air sacs (alveoli) in the lungs. The interstitium is accountable for supporting the alveoli and assisting in the exchange of oxygen and co2. When this tissue becomes inflamed or scarred, it can lead to a range of signs and problems.

Types of ILD:

  • Idiopathic Pulmonary Fibrosis (IPF): A progressive and typically deadly kind of ILD without any known cause.
  • Hypersensitivity Pneumonitis: An allergic response to breathed in organic dusts or chemicals.
  • Sarcoidosis: An inflammatory disease that can impact multiple organs, but mainly the lungs.
  • Occupational ILD: Caused by prolonged exposure to particular occupational risks, such as silica, asbestos, and coal dust.

The Railroad Industry and ILD

Railroad workers are at a higher danger of establishing ILD due to their prolonged exposure to numerous environmental and occupational threats. Some of the key factors include:

  1. Dust and Particulate Matter:

    • Coal Dust: Workers in coal-fired locomotives are exposed to coal dust, which can cause chronic lung inflammation and swelling.
    • Diesel Exhaust: Diesel engines discharge fine particulate matter and harmful gases, consisting of nitrogen dioxide and sulfur dioxide, which can damage the lungs over time.
    • Asbestos: Older railroad vehicles and structures might consist of asbestos, a known carcinogen that can cause lung cancer and asbestosis.
  2. Chemical Exposures:

    • Solvents and Cleaners: Railroad employees often use solvents and cleaning agents that can release unpredictable natural substances (VOCs) and other harmful chemicals.
    • Lubes and Greases: These can consist of harmful compounds that, when inhaled, can lead to respiratory concerns.
  3. Physical Strain:

    • Repetitive Motion: The physical demands of railroad work, including heavy lifting and repetitive movements, can worsen breathing problems.
    • Vibration: Prolonged direct exposure to vibration from machinery and devices can likewise contribute to lung damage.

Signs and Diagnosis

The symptoms of ILD can vary depending upon the type and seriousness of the illness. Typical symptoms consist of:

  • Shortness of Breath: Especially throughout exercise.
  • Dry Cough: Persistent and frequently ineffective.
  • Tiredness: Generalized tiredness and absence of energy.
  • Chest Pain: Often referred to as a dull ache or sharp pain.
  • Weight-loss: Unintentional and often rapid.

Medical diagnosis:

  • Physical Examination: A doctor will listen to the lungs and inspect for indications of respiratory distress.
  • Imaging Tests: Chest X-rays and CT scans can assist picture lung damage and inflammation.
  • Pulmonary Function Tests: These tests measure lung capacity and the capability to exchange oxygen and carbon dioxide.
  • Biopsy: In some cases, a lung biopsy might be required to verify the medical diagnosis.

Treatment and Management

While there is no cure for ILD, several treatment choices can help handle signs and slow the development of the disease:

  1. Medications:

    • Anti-inflammatory Drugs: Corticosteroids can reduce inflammation in the lungs.
    • Antifibrotic Drugs: Medications like pirfenidone and nintedanib can slow the scarring process.
    • Oxygen Therapy: Supplemental oxygen can enhance breathing and reduce shortness of breath.
  2. Lifestyle Changes:

    • Smoking Cessation: Quitting smoking is vital for preventing further lung damage.
    • Workout: Regular, low-impact exercise can improve lung function and total health.
    • Diet: A balanced diet rich in antioxidants and anti-inflammatory foods can support lung health.
  3. Encouraging Care:

    • Pulmonary Rehabilitation: Programs that combine exercise, education, and support to improve lifestyle.
    • Support system: Connecting with others who have ILD can offer psychological support and practical suggestions.

Preventive Measures

Avoiding ILD in railroad employees involves a multi-faceted technique that includes both private and organizational efforts:

  1. Personal Protective Equipment (PPE):

    • Respirators: Wearing N95 respirators can minimize direct exposure to dust and particle matter.
    • Gloves and Goggles: Protecting the skin and eyes from chemical direct exposures.
  2. Work environment Safety:

    • Ventilation: Ensuring appropriate ventilation in work areas to lower the concentration of damaging substances.
    • Routine Maintenance: Keeping equipment and equipment in good working order to decrease emissions.
    • Training: Providing employees with training on the appropriate use of PPE and safe work practices.
  3. Health Monitoring:

    • Regular Check-ups: Scheduling routine medical check-ups to monitor lung health.
    • Screening Programs: Implementing screening programs to determine early signs of ILD.

Often Asked Questions (FAQs)

Q: What are the early signs of interstitial lung illness?A: Early signs of ILD include shortness of breath, specifically during exercise, a dry cough, and tiredness. These symptoms may be subtle at first but can intensify with time.

Q: Can ILD be reversed?A: While some types of ILD can improve with treatment, lots of cases are progressive and irreversible. The objective of treatment is to handle symptoms and slow the development of the disease.

Q: How can railroad employees reduce their danger of developing ILD?A: Railroad workers can decrease their danger by wearing proper PPE, guaranteeing excellent ventilation in work areas, and following safe work practices. Regular health check-ups and screenings are also essential.

Q: What should I do if I presume I have ILD?A: If you think you have ILD, it is essential to seek medical attention without delay. A doctor can perform a physical exam, order imaging tests, and perform pulmonary function tests to diagnose the condition.

Q: Are there any support system for people with ILD?A: Yes, there are a number of assistance groups and companies that supply resources and assistance for people with ILD. These groups can provide emotional assistance, practical recommendations, and details about treatment alternatives.
